BUSINESS NOTES.

Miss Mildred Turner will resume music teaching on Tuesday, inext. Tenders are invited by the Oniaka Road Board for gravelling at Springlands. ■ The programme to be rendered at the concert in aid of the local Fire Brigade on Wednesday next appears today. Levin and Co.'s next wool, skin and hide sale will takel place on the I9th instant. The monthly meeting of the Wairau No-License League is to be held on Monday evening next. Miss V. Brewer has on sale ladies' knitted blouses and other knitted goods. There is nothing to equal Witch's Oil for rheumatism, sciatica, lumbago, and all muscular pains. 3 W. Carr has just landed stoves of various kinds, also best brands'of kerosene, benzine, and machine oils. Entries for the stock sale to be held by the Loan and Mercantile Company at their Blenheim yards on Wednesday next are advertised to-day. A reward is offered for the return of a lost bracelet.
